Transaction 058fa99aa98f3da59fb1127797bffced8760a0f667711b7f475f0208a064abad

1 Input
2 Outputs
  • 058fa99aa98f3da59fb1127797bffced8760a0f667711b7f475f0208a064abad:0
  • value  604057320
    address  13hVbC5aDQaoxtgNfW245KHHuUBKPZt6x6
  • 058fa99aa98f3da59fb1127797bffced8760a0f667711b7f475f0208a064abad:1
  • value  1618602776
    address  18ng5xqLRmqGN1wsvwUk1pbeoHTtbXvuhh